Seattle Seahawks information
The Seattle Seahawks are currently members of the NFC West division, as they were when they first entered the league in 1976. After the 1st season, however, the Seahawks switched places with the Tampa Bay Buccaneers and joined the AFC West. They would remain in the AFC for 26 years until 2002 when the NFL realigned the divisions due to the increasing number of franchises. The Seahawks were once again added to the NFC West making them the only team in history to switch conferences twice.

In their 30 year history, the Seahawks have made the playoffs 7 times and have advanced to the Super Bowl only once. That Super Bowl appearance was in XL losing to the Pittsburgh Steelers. Seattle has won the AFC west division twice and the NFC west division twice. They are also the only team in history to have played in a conference championship game for both the NFC and AFC.

The Seahawks have had some Hall of Fame players on their roster over the years. They include: Carl Eller, Franco Harris, Steve Largent, Warren Moon, and Jerry Rice. Of those players, Steve Largent is the most recognized by the Seahawk faithful as he played his entire career (aside from 3 preseason games) in Seattle. He was a pro-bowler 7 times and is a member of the 1980's All-Decade Team and not to mention a former member of the House of Representatives.

The Seahawk fans are some of the most devoted and recognized in the NFL; they are nick-named "The Twelfth Man." This name came about because the noise level the fans create when the opposition has the ball is such an advantage it is like they are playing with an extra man on the field. The team has even retired the number 12, in dedication to the fans.
